Author

Byron

Title

Childe Harold's pilgrimage :, a romaunt /, by Lord Byron.

Publication, distribution, etc.

London :, John Murray, Albemarle Street,, MDCCCXLI [1841]

Physical description

xvi, 320 p., [3] leaves of plates (1 folded) :, ill. (engravings), map, port. ;, 23 cm.

Note

With additional engraved title-page.

Note

With a half-title.

Note

Includes notes.

Provenance

Armorial bookplate of Eton College School Library recording donation: "Major General Villiers Hatton" (typed).

Provenance

Armorial bookplate of Villiers Hatton.

Provenance

Ms. bookseller's note and codes in pencil.

Provenance

Presentation copy from Lord Sidney herbert to the Hon. Mrs. Norton (information from bookseller's note) with ms. annotation on p. 89 and ms. initials on pp. 168, 320, and map: "S. H."

Binding

Late 19th / early 20th century blue leather with coloured leather inlays, gilt tooling and lettering, cream silk endpapers and tooled and coloured tan calf pastedown ; gauffered gilt edges with three paintings on fore-edge ; housed in original blue leather, cloth and marbled paper box with gilt lettering ; bound by Fazakerley, Liverpool (binder's stamp on front pastedown).

Copy-specific note

Ms. previous shelfmarks in pencil.
